### **A Look Back at the 2005 NRL Premiership**
The highlight of the evening was undoubtedly the **2005 NRL Premiership** victory, a triumph that is forever etched in the club’s history. As the Tigers’ lone premiership to date, this achievement continues to be a source of immense pride for the club, its fans, and its players. During the dinner, footage of the **grand final** was shown on the big screens, bringing back the memories of that historic win.
For fans who were there that day, it was a moment to relive the excitement of the final, which saw the Tigers defeat the **North Queensland Cowboys** in one of the most dramatic NRL grand finals ever played. The Tigers’ **12-10 victory** was a culmination of years of hard work, dedication, and belief in their ability to succeed. The dinner allowed for a collective moment of nostalgia, as supporters recalled the thrilling moments, particularly **Benji Marshall’s** infamous flick pass, which has become one of the most iconic plays in rugby league history.
